Gilder Lehrman Collection #: GLC02415.004 Author/Creator: Kellogg, James H. (fl. 1862-1864) Place Written: Near Louisville, KY Type: Autograph letter signed Date: 21 September 1862 Pagination: 4 p. ; 13.6 x 21.2 cm. Order a Copy

They are camped in a very nice area near Louisville. There is a large plantation with lots of sweet potatoes. He asks if Taylor has decided to take the farm yet and if not she will have to let it. He asks if she heard from Wes
